Output ed624164306643f685a62e12915c6a7c75de372d37a8f74c002b0c28e7e0ba24:95

value
301836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b48853335a23b7f4e5773172770469bc254c866 OP_EQUAL
address
3P95bRX7WXSqbkbHE6hbAjKUQbEJEvv6JU
transaction
ed624164306643f685a62e12915c6a7c75de372d37a8f74c002b0c28e7e0ba24
spent
true